Protein Banana Bread Recipe

Description

This Protein Banana Bread is a delicious and nutritious twist on traditional banana bread. Packed with protein from almond flour and vanilla protein powder, it makes for a satisfying breakfast or snack option.


Ingredients

Scale

Wet Ingredients:

  • 3 ripe bananas (mashed)
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1/3 cup maple syrup or honey
  • 1/4 cup plain Greek yogurt
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Dry Ingredients:

  • 1 1/2 cups almond flour
  • 1/2 cup vanilla protein powder
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 cup chopped walnuts or chocolate chips (optional)

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ven: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9×5-inch loaf pan or line it with parchment paper.
  2. Mix wet ingredients: In a large bowl, mash the bananas, then whisk in the eggs, maple syrup (or honey), Greek yogurt, and vanilla extract until smooth.
  3. Combine dry ingredients: In a separate bowl, whisk together the almond flour, protein powder, baking soda, baking powder, cinnamon, and salt.
  4. Combine wet and dry ingredients: Add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ients and stir until fully combined. Fold in walnuts or chocolate chips if using.
  5. Bake: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an and smooth the top. Bake for 40–45 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
  6. Cool and slice: Allow to cool in the pan for 10 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ely before slicing.

Notes

  • For added protein, use a high-quality whey or plant-based vanilla protein powder.
  • You can substitute Greek yogurt with unsweetened applesauce for a dairy-free version.
  • Add chopped nuts or seeds for crunch and extra nutrients.
